Kim Chung-ha (born Kim Chan-mi on February 9, 1996), better known by the mononym Chungha, is a South Korean singer. She is best known for finishing fourth in Mnet's girl group survival show Produce 101 and as a former member of the now disbanded South Korean girl group I.O.I.

Kim Chung-ha (Korean: 김청하; born Kim Chan-mi, February 9, 1996), known mononymously as Chung Ha (stylized in all caps), is a South Korean singer, dancer and choreographer. She finished fourth in Mnet's girl group survival show Produce 101, becoming a member of the resulting girl group I.O.I. Following the dissolution of I.O.I in 2017, Chung Ha debuted as a solo artist with the extended play Hands on Me.
